From Studio to Stream: The Essential Steps in Music Distribution
So you've poured your heart and soul into crafting the ultimate track. It's polished, it's ready, and now you're eager to share it with the world. But getting your music from the studio to streaming platforms requires a few key steps. First, you need to opt for a distributor. These companies act as the bridge between your music and the global audience. A reputable distributor will handle everything from uploading your tracks to ensuring they're properly cataloged.
Next, prepare your track information. This includes things like titles, performer names, song lengths, and genres. Accurate metadata is crucial for helping fans find your music and for streaming services to sort it correctly.
- Don't forget the cover art! A stunning image will make your release stand out.
- Once everything is in place, submit your music to the distributor. They'll take care of getting it onto major platforms like Spotify, Apple Music, and Amazon Music.
- Finally, promote! Share your new release on social media, reach out to influencers, and engage with your fans.
With a little planning and effort, you can successfully distribute your music and start building a loyal following.
Understanding Music Rights and Royalties in Distribution
Navigating the world of music rights and royalties can feel like trekking uncharted territory. It's a labyrinth of legal language, where artists, producers and distributors often find themselves tangled in a complex web of agreements. But don't worry! This article aims to shed some light on the fundamentals of music rights and royalties, illuminating this often-confusing landscape.
First, let's understand the difference between performance rights and mechanical rights. Performance rights grant permission for a song to be publicly played, while mechanical rights authorize the reproduction of a song on physical or digital media.
When music is distributed, various parties are involved in the income stream. The artist typically obtains royalties for each download of their music. Distributors also play a crucial role, as they negotiate agreements with streaming platforms to ensure that artists are fairly compensated for their work.
Understanding these basic principles can empower artists and creators to make informed decisions about their music distribution and optimize their earnings potential.

Maximize Your Impact: Choosing the Right Music Distribution Platform
Hitting the audio world with your creations is an exciting journey. But to truly make your mark and reach a global audience, choosing the right music distribution platform is crucial. Think of it as picking the click here ideal launchpad for your sonic masterpiece. A good platform will not only get your music into the hands of fans but also escalate its visibility across various streaming services and online stores.
There are a ton of platforms out there, each with its own uniqueness. Some are known for their vast reach, while others offer niche expertise. It's important to carefully consider your objectives as an artist and the kind of impact you want to make.
Here are some key factors to think about when making your decision:
* Fees: Different platforms have different pricing structures, so find one that fits your budget and offers value for your investment.
* Exposure: Some platforms boast a wider reach across streaming services and online stores than others. Consider where your target audience spends their time listening to music.
* Features: Look for platforms that offer tools to help you promote your music, track your progress, and connect with fans.
By carefully weighing these factors, you can choose the platform that best aligns with your artistic vision and helps you achieve your musical dreams.
